How They Are Made: A Tale of Two Processes
The fundamental difference between cold-pressed and refined oils lies in their extraction process. Cold-pressed oils are made by simply crushing seeds or nuts and forcing out the oil through pressure. This mechanical, low-temperature method, often called
'kachchi ghani' or 'wood-pressed', ensures that the oil retains its natural flavour, aroma, and, most importantly, its nutritional compounds like antioxidants and vitamins. Refined oils, however, are produced on an industrial scale. The process involves high heat and chemical solvents, like hexane, to extract the maximum amount of oil. This is followed by further stages of bleaching to lighten the colour and deodorising to create a neutral flavour. While this method increases the oil's shelf life and stability, it strips away many of the beneficial nutrients, including vitamins and antioxidants.
The Nutritional Divide
Because of their gentle extraction, cold-pressed oils are nutritionally superior. They are rich in essential fatty acids, antioxidants like vitamin E, and other micronutrients that are naturally present in the seed. These components are vital for fighting inflammation and cellular damage in the body. For example, a significant amount of the antioxidant content can be lost during the refining process, making cold-pressed oils a better choice for overall wellness. Refined oils, on the other hand, are often described as providing 'empty calories'. The high-heat processing not only removes vitamins but can also alter the chemical structure of the fats. Sometimes, this can lead to the formation of trans fats, which are known to be detrimental to heart health by raising bad LDL cholesterol levels. Furthermore, many refined oils have an imbalanced ratio of omega-6 to omega-3 fatty acids, which can contribute to inflammation in the body.
The Heat is On: Smoke Point and Daily Cooking
This is where refined oils often claim an advantage. The smoke point is the temperature at which an oil begins to break down and produce visible smoke. Exceeding this temperature not only ruins the flavour but also releases harmful free radicals. Refined oils generally have a higher smoke point because the impurities that burn at lower temperatures have been removed. This makes them seem suitable for high-heat cooking methods like deep frying. However, many common Indian cold-pressed oils have smoke points that are perfectly adequate for daily cooking. Cold-pressed mustard oil, for instance, has a relatively high smoke point, making it suitable for frying. Cold-pressed groundnut and sesame oils are also robust enough for sautéing and 'tadkas'. The key is to match the oil to the cooking method. For low-heat sautéing, dressings, and drizzling over finished dishes, flavourful cold-pressed oils are ideal.
The Heart of the Matter: Which Is Better?
For heart health, the evidence points towards cold-pressed oils. Their high antioxidant content and healthy fats help protect against oxidative stress and may support balanced cholesterol levels. The minimal processing ensures you are getting the oil in its most natural form, free from chemical residues and harmful trans fats that can be created during refining. Regular consumption of refined oils has been associated with an increased risk of cardiovascular issues, largely due to the high processing and potential for creating unhealthy compounds. Popular cold-pressed options for Indian kitchens include mustard, coconut, groundnut, and sesame oil. Each offers a unique flavour profile and set of health benefits. Mustard oil is rich in omega-3s, while coconut oil contains easily digestible medium-chain triglycerides.
